The story of Alma Koch began in 1902 in Oklahoma. In 1910, Alma Koch resided in Bessie, Washita, Oklahoma, USA. Alma Koch married William Arthur Hefley, and had children including Bety Louise Hefley, Billie Jean Hefley, Joy Hefley, Joyce Hefley, Justus Woody Hefley, Sallie Marie Hefley. Alma Koch passed away in 1977 in Rocky Ford, Otero County, Colorado, United States of America.
